Steve Magness Issues Passionate Rebuttal To Alberto Salazar’s Open Letter: “(Salazar’s) statements actually confirm what I witnessed and what I told to the BBC/ProPublica reporters in their documentary last month” – LetsRun.com
|Magness reveals that Salazar trusted his coaching ability so much that he was given complete control of the team for 10 days just weeks before the 2012 Olympic Trials. He also says that he knew he’d be attacked by Salazar and have his career put in jeopardy if he came forward but but it’s something he had to do so he can “walk away with a clean consicience.” Magness: “I thank the others who have showed incredible courage and determination in taking a stance for clean sport. While it is incredibly intimidating and no doubt will result in your reputation being attacked, at least you can walk away with a clean conscience.”
